

Ecocide
2019 World Events REGULAR
In 2010, BP's Deepwater Horizon oil rig exploded killing 11 men. Over
200 million gallons of oil poured into the sea for 3 months impacting an
area the size of England and Scotland combined. The first oil spills
washed ashore on Grand Isle, Louisiana. Years later, while th+More
English















